FAQs:
1. What are the top pharmacy colleges in Gorakhpur?
Some of the best colleges include Maharana Pratap College of Pharmacy, ITM College of Pharmacy, KIPM College of Pharmacy, and Sun Institute of Pharmaceutical Education and Research.
2. What pharmacy courses are available in Gorakhpur?
Students can pursue: D.Pharm (Diploma in Pharmacy) B.Pharm (Bachelor of Pharmacy) M.Pharm (Master of Pharmacy)
3. What is the eligibility for B.Pharm?
10+2 with Physics, Chemistry, Biology/Mathematics Minimum 50% marks Some colleges may require entrance exams
4. What is the duration of pharmacy courses?
D.Pharm: 2 years B.Pharm: 4 years M.Pharm: 2 years
5. What is the average fee for pharmacy courses in Gorakhpur?
D.Pharm: ₹40,000 – ₹1,00,000 per year B.Pharm: ₹70,000 – ₹1,50,000 per year M.Pharm: ₹1,00,000 – ₹2,00,000 per year
